    St Simeon is a lovely tiny town on the St Lawrence River.

    St Simeon is a lovely tiny town on the St Lawrence River. It has a ferry that crosses over to the south shore of the St Lawrence River to Riviere du Loup. We stayed 2 blocks from the ferry terminal. There is a waterfront park there with picnic tables, a public washroom, and water access if you have your own kayaks or paddle boards. The local garage fixed our flat tire without any waiting. We just showed up and they fixed it right away. Thank you. Across the street from the ferry terminal is a cafe coffee shop. They make great coffees and have baked treats as well as sandwiches and wraps. We ate supper at the Restaurant sur Mer, a quick walk from the Cofotel Hotel ( we were given a free upgrade) where we were staying. Every table has a view of the St Lawrence. There were no vegan options here so we ate a vegetable soup and garden salad and fries. We were so grateful for the kindness and generosity of the people here: from the garage Savard that fixed our flat tire in record time, to the free upgrade at the Cofotel hotel, thank you. We will be back.

    The Gentilhommiere in Saint-Simeon is a beautiful, centrally located property where the Rive Noire meets the St. Lawrence. Based here we drove 20 miles north to Tadoussac to catch the “Navettes du Fjord” 11:30-5pm boat up the Saguenay River to L’Anse Saint Jean sighting Beluga Whales en route. Just a few miles south is Port au Persil, a photogenic park great for whale watching. The Gentilhommiere hosts are exceptionally gracious and helpful.
